I wasn't disappointed. Filled with dramatic and improved special effects (it was now several years from the first Star Wars movie), spectacular cinematography, absolutely fabulous costumes, beautifully done sets, and a stellar cast, this movie delivers on all counts. I suspect just their costume budget was more than the original Star Wars movie.
The plot is well known, so I won't comment there. But the entire cast looks like they're having a grand time with this campy, fun-filled, futuristic romp. Brian Blessed, who plays Vultan, the king of the Hawkmen, looks like he's having the time of his life. In fact, while watching the movie that I reflected that I couldn't ever recall seeing an actor having such an uproarious, rip-snorting good time playing a role. He is absolutely beside himself with the pleasure of playing that part, and I just found out why after doing a little research on the IMDB site. Here's an except from the page there:
"As a child he and his friends used to play at Flash Gordon, inspired by the Buster Crabbe TV serials. In these childhood games Brian would always play Vultan, leader of the Hawkmen. In the 1980 film Flash Gordon he played the same role as he had in childhood."
No wonder Brian is having such a good time. :-) It's amazing that he got to play the role of his favorite character in the big screen movie. Good for Brian, who has always been one of my favorite actors. What an amazing coincidence and stroke of good luck for Brian.
All the actors are great too, and Max von Sydow is perfect as the evil Ming. But everyone else in the cast is superb also, including the ones I didn't know as well, and I only knew Timothy Dalton from his James Bond roles.

Fantastic and humorous Sci-fi fantasy comedy based on a classic 30's comic strip, producer Dino De Laurentiis and his studio has brought the comic to life in a grand and yet silly way. The film also stars Timothy Dalton, Kenny Baker and Richard O'Brien, this a delightful and colorful epic that i loved since i was a kid and still love. As of today it has gained a cult following for it's quirkiness and entertainment value, the music score by Queen is just awesome especially the theme song that no one forgets and i highly recommend this movie for good escapist fun.
This special edition DVD contains excellent remastered picture and sound with some fine extras like the Theatrical trailer, two featurettes, a 1936 Flash Gordon serial and sneek preview of the new Flash Gordon series plus a cool Postcard sized artwork of Flash Gordon from Alex Ross.
